Output 17d2521678780d6e78961aa92da6e4c1fe7bea6f6b82d3e0b712516aabd91b69:0

value
1569678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d4090b75a5b0a80615bbb725f0545282310dfb OP_EQUAL
address
35sLLecBVMbQoZQnECD74gUBAv6i6eaYaQ
transaction
17d2521678780d6e78961aa92da6e4c1fe7bea6f6b82d3e0b712516aabd91b69
spent
true